A kind of packing element anchoring separate layer water injection string
Technical field
The utility model relates to water injection string, especially a kind of packing element is anchored separate layer water injection string.
Background technique
Seperated layer water injection is the means the most cost-effective that long-term high yeild stable yields is realized in oil field.Since conditions down-hole is complicated, Separate layer water injection string can usually wriggle because of unbalance stress, so that influencing the sealing effect of layer separating packer leads to water injection string Layering failure.The method for being anchored water injection string under present condition using tools such as mating hydraulic anchor, hydraulic slips is to utilize anchor Contact firmly to realize the anchoring to tubing string for tooth and slip insert and internal surface of sleeve pipe, it is not only easy that casing is caused to damage, more exist Later period working string meets the risk that card hands over overhaul.
By patent searching library, in water injection string, the anchor being substantially contacts anchoring firmly, does not find to use The water injection string of anchoring packer, in addition anchoring packer is the double glue of the prior art, direct use, such as anchor expanding type Cylinder packer 200920219557.9, anchoring expansion type packer 200910016235.9.

The utility model has the advantages that compared with prior art:
The utility model uses anchor tool of the inflatable anchoring packer as separate layer water injection string, is insulated using anchoring Device packing element is swollen to be tamping soft anchoring of the stiction realization packing element of patch internal surface of sleeve pipe to water injection string.On tubular column structure, filling the water The above tubing string of interval is provided with tubing string Telescopic short piece, to adapt to the deformation of the above oil pipe of water injection string, prevents to wriggle.Water filling In the tubing string of interval, it is provided with upper anchoring packer being located at the above position in the top oil reservoir upper bound, is being located at bottom oil layer lower bound Following position is provided with lower anchoring packer, and interlayer can be arranged in nearly layer separating packer position according to specific requirements in oil layer section tubing string Anchoring packer.The use of anchoring packer can effectively be anchored separate layer water injection string, prevent it from wriggling.Meanwhile it is logical It crosses the upper anchoring packer of setting and lower anchoring packer ensure that water filling interval tubing string whole stress equalization in the injecting process, from And further reduce the peristaltic forces of tubing string.

Embodiment:
After separate layer water injection string is lowered into oil reservoir position according to the structure of design, water injection well is just filled the water, anchoring packer and Layer separating packer can be completed using the pressure difference between water filling and stratum and set.During water filling, the glue of anchoring packer Envelope that cylinder is swollen can be closely attached to play the role of being anchored water injection string on internal surface of sleeve pipe.And due in water filling interval tubing string It is upper to be provided with upper and lower anchoring packer, so that the tubing string stress equalization of each water filling interval of water injection pipe shell of column is to ensure that Entire water filling interval tubing string stress equalization, further weakens the wriggling of tubing string, extends tubing string validity period.It is flexible by tubing string simultaneously The flexible deformation quantity that can offset the above oil pipe of water injection string of pipe nipple, prevents it from wriggling.When stopping note, anchoring packer glue Cylinder is withdrawn, and is released the anchoring to tubing string and is acted on.The design of tubing string bottom has check valve+screen casing+silk plug combination, realizes anti-flushing well.
The utility model, to the soft anchoring of tubing string, can be effectively prevented wriggling of the tubing string in the injecting process and cause using packing element The problem of layering failure, and can cause damage to avoid existing anchor tool to casing and reduce later period inspection pipe to meet card friendship overhaul Risk.
